Re: Balsa core

Balsa density varies from 150-320 kg/m3. It depends where this blank was originally located in the log.

Re: Repair board suggestion

You can seal the crack, but if the core is destroyed (or damaged) all the pressure will concentrate in that cracked aria and it will lead to full destruction. You also have to fix core, replace damaged part, or compensate it with laminate. But the board will never be the same again. Probably repair ...
